Market Sizing, Growth Estimates, and CAGR Projections

Based on the latest industry data, the South Korea medical imaging management market was valued at approximately USD 1.2 billion

in 2023. This valuation encompasses software solutions, hardware integration, system management services, and related lifecycle support. The market is projected to grow at a compound annual growth rate (CAGR) of 8.5% to 10%

over the next five years, reaching an estimated USD 2.0 billion

by 2028.

Assumptions underpinning these estimates include increased adoption of digital health records, government initiatives promoting healthcare digitization, and the rising prevalence of chronic diseases requiring advanced imaging diagnostics. Additionally, the integration of AI and cloud-based management solutions is expected to accelerate market expansion.

Market Ecosystem and Operational Framework

Key Product Categories

  • Imaging Management Software:

    PACS, RIS (Radiology Information Systems), and Vendor Neutral Archives (VNAs) form the core offerings.

  • Hardware Components:

    Servers, storage devices, and network infrastructure supporting imaging data management.

  • Lifecycle Services:

    Maintenance, upgrades, training, and technical support services.

Digital Transformation and Interoperability Impact

The market is witnessing a paradigm shift driven by digital transformation initiatives. Cloud-based PACS and RIS solutions enable remote access, scalability, and cost efficiencies. Interoperability standards like DICOM and HL7 are critical for integrating imaging management systems with Electronic Medical Records (EMRs) and Hospital Information Systems (HIS). Cross-industry collaborations with AI firms, cloud providers, and telehealth platforms are fostering innovative service models, including AI-assisted diagnostics and remote image review.

Cost Structures, Pricing Strategies, and Investment Patterns

Hardware costs constitute approximately 40-50% of total expenditure, with software licensing and subscription fees accounting for 30-40%. Operating margins vary between 15-25%, influenced by R&D investments, regulatory compliance costs, and competitive pricing. Capital investments are predominantly driven by hospital modernization programs and government grants, with a trend towards subscription-based models to reduce upfront costs and facilitate upgrades.

Competitive Landscape Overview

Key global players include Philips Healthcare, GE Healthcare, Siemens Healthineers, and Fujifilm Medical Systems, focusing on innovation, strategic partnerships, and regional expansion. Regional players such as Samsung Medison and local integrators are also significant, emphasizing tailored solutions and cost leadership.

Segment Analysis: Product Type, Technology, Application, and Distribution

  • Product Type:

    PACS dominates with over 60% market share, followed by RIS and VNAs.

  • Technology:

    Cloud-based solutions are the fastest-growing segment, with AI integration gaining momentum.

  • Application:

    Oncology, cardiology, neurology, and general radiology are primary application areas, with oncology showing the highest growth potential.

  • Distribution Channel:

    Direct sales to hospitals and clinics remain dominant, but online and channel partner sales are expanding rapidly.
